Here at Partygirl we know we are nothing without our essentials. Some of our best DIY's and party tricks are done on an "As-We-Dream-It-Up" basis. AKA.... on the fly. To make this happen we always have a PartyGirl tool box full of tricks that is ready at any moment and we think you should too. Our favorite essentials store is Michael's but any craft or paper source store will have what you need. Here are a few essentials to get you started!
Tool Box: Essential for obvious reasons. We love that it's fairly small and can be stored anywhere without taking up tons of room. It holds a ton of stuff and can be painted (or glittered) easily if wanted.
Glue Gun: Probably the most important thing in the entire PartyGirl tool box. It's small and compact so you can carry with you to events for touch ups on the fly. It's quick and very effective.
Scissors: No explanation necessary. You'll always need them!
Glitter: It's like having sugar in your kitchen... it can spruce up anything and the same can be said for a little glitter. It just always comes in handy.
Tape Measure: We love this small little guy because it's easy to keep in your kit or throw in your bag without taking up much room.
Modge Podge: The BEST for glittering pretty much anything. Learn to love it!
Foam brushes: the best for Modge Podge-ing anything. Also great for painting as well. They clean out quick and are super cheap so you can always have a bunch on hand.
Sharpie Marker: Labels, Gift cards, Posters.... we could go on for days.
Exacto Knife: For tearing boxes open, crafting and for when your scissors just won't cut it.
Scotch Tape: Because it's also just a life essential.
Ribbon and Bows: You never know when you'll need to do a quick gift wrap or pull together a dinner party in record time.
E6000: When you have a little more time for drying and need a stronger hold than a glue gun this is your answer!
A bottle of paint: Our wild card item. We love a metallic Martha Stewart paint for making things sparkle just a little more if needed. You probably have a wild card essential too!
